Antique 14" Royal Worcester Snake Handle Ewer Shape 137 A. Stowell Boston Blush Ivory
Made in England c. 1880s – 1890s for the A. Stowell Co. Boston importer.
Approx. 14" High x 6" Wide to Handle x 5 1/2" Diameter at Widest.
Magnificent and highly collectible Royal Worcester blush ivory fine porcelain ewer, standing an impressive 14 inches tall.
This is the large-scale, exhibition-sized variant of the historic factory Shape 137, featuring one of Royal Worcester’s most sought-after figural designs: a fully modeled, three-dimensional snake (serpent) acting as the handle.
This particular piece was a custom luxury export order, featuring the red stamped retailer back stamp for A. Stowell & Co. of Boston, Massachusetts, a prestigious late 19th-century jeweler and luxury importer.
The ewer features a classic ovoid body finished in Royal Worcester’s iconic satin matte "Blush Ivory" glaze.
It is meticulously hand-painted with delicate late-Victorian wildflowers, thistles, and foliage, highlighted by heavy, raised liquid gold detailing.
The handle is a masterpiece of Victorian ceramic modeling, depicting a serpent slithering up the neck of the jug. The snake's tail anchors into a basket-weave molded collar at the shoulder, while its head rests elegantly near the heavily gilded, scalloped trefoil rim.
The crisp, three-digit factory shape number 137 is impressed into the underside of the base.
Stamped in red underglaze is the historic retailer mark: "A. STOWELL & CO. BOSTON."
